Roots: Anchors and Absorbers
Roots are the foundation of any plant’s existence. They provide stability by anchoring the plant firmly in the ground while also serving as vital organs for water absorption. The Sapphire Showers plant has a fibrous root system, consisting of numerous thin, branching roots that spread out horizontally just below the soil surface.
One remarkable characteristic of the Sapphire Showers plant’s roots is their ability to adapt to different soil conditions. They are capable of penetrating through compacted soil, allowing the plant to thrive even in areas with poor drainage. This adaptability ensures that the plant can obtain sufficient water and nutrients from the soil.
Additionally, the roots of the Sapphire Showers plant play an essential role in preventing erosion. Their intricate network helps bind the soil particles together, reducing the risk of soil erosion during heavy rainfall or strong winds.
Stems: Support and Transport
Stems are responsible for providing structural support to plants, allowing them to stand upright against gravity. In the case of the Sapphire Showers plant, its stems are woody and erect. As the plant grows, the stems become thicker and stronger, providing stability to the cascading branches laden with flowers.
Apart from their structural role, stems also serve as conduits for transporting water, nutrients, and sugars throughout the plant. In the Sapphire Showers plant, there is a continuous flow of water and nutrients from the roots to the leaves, and vice versa, through the stem’s vascular system. This transport system, known as xylem and phloem, ensures that all parts of the plant receive the necessary resources for growth and survival.
The stems of the Sapphire Showers plant are also capable of vegetative propagation. This means that a stem cutting taken from a mature plant can be rooted and grown into a new plant. This ability is advantageous for propagation purposes, allowing gardeners to easily propagate multiple plants from a single parent plant.
